How Crawl Space Water Removal Works
When you call us, our team will arrive quickly to assess the damage and develop a customized plan to remove the water and repair any dam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to extract water from your crawl space, and our technicians will work tirelessly to dry out the area and prevent further damage. We’ll get the job done right, the first time. Our process is designed to reduce disruption to your daily life, so you can get back to normal as soon as possible.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our team will arrive quickly to assess the damage and develop a customized plan to remove the water and repair any dam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to extract water from your crawl space. Our team knows the area, and we know the job.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use specialized equipment to extract water from your crawl space, including wet/dry vacuums and submersible pumps. We’ll get the water out quickly and efficiently.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use specialized equipment to dry out your crawl space and prevent further damage. Our technicians will work tirelessly to ensure that your home is safe and dry. We’ll get the job done right, the first time.
Step 4: Repair and Restoration
Once your crawl space is dry and safe, our team will work to repair any damage caused by the water. We’ll replace damaged insulation, repair or replace any damaged structural elements, and ensure that your home is back to normal. We’ll make it like new.

Crawl Space Water Removal Cost In Poulsbo, WA
The cost of crawl space water removal in Poulsbo, WA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. We’ll provide a free estimate to help you understand the costs involved. Our prices range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the scope of the job.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and removal | $500 – $1,500 | The amount of water to be extracted and the tools and equipment required. |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the type of equipment required. |
| Repair and restoration | $1,500 – $3,500 | The extent of the damage and the materials required for repair. |
| Disinfection and sanitizing | $500 – $1,000 | The size of the affected area and the type of disinfectants required. |
| Odor removal and deodorizing | $500 – $1,000 | The size of the affected area and the type of deodorizers required. |
| Final inspection and certification | $200 – $500 | The complexity of the job and the number of inspections required. |
